Note: The previous name Pt100 has been changed to JPt100 in
accordance with revisions to JIS. The previous name J-DIN has
been changed to L in accordance with revisions to DIN
standards.
Note: Turn OFF the power before changing the DIP switch settings on the E5CSV. Each of the switch settings will be enabled after the power is
turned ON.
For details on the position of the temperature range switch, control mode switches, and alarm mode switch, refer to page 4.
